The NBA Hosted their annual All Star Saturday Night as part of All Star Weekend from Houston this past weekend. In the past we have seen Michael Jordan win back to back Slam Dunk competitions and Larry Bird win back to back to back 3 point competitions in the past. This weekend may have been about the emergence of Kyrie Irving and Kenneth Faried.
3 – Point Contest Winner: Kyrie Irving, Cleveland Cavaliers.
Australian born Irving walked away the winner of the 2013 3 point contest after a blistering 23 point showing in the championship round against the “Red-Mamba” Matt Bonner who could only manage 20. This year’s field was strong with the inclusions Steph Curry, Paul George, Steve Novak and Ryan Anderson.
Slam Dunk Contest winner: Terrence Ross, Toronto Raptors
The competition was split into East vs West and initially the East dominated. Each dunker from the West was disappointing, their dunks were uninspiring and boring. It took Utah’s Jeremy Evan’s first dunk in the final round before things got interesting as he jumped a easel which he would later reveal as a painting of himself winning last years dunk competition. Terrence Ross’ first dunk in the finals was a Vince Carter tribute dunk followed by a between the legs dunk starting behind the backboard out of bounds.
